Abstract

A method may include receiving a setting for a component of a bed architecture and a trigger condition for the setting; generating a sleep profile with the setting and trigger condition; activating the sleep profile when the trigger condition has been met; and based on the activation of the sleep profile, transmitting a signal to the component to adjust to the setting.

Claims (43)

1 . A method comprising:

receiving a setting for a component of a bed architecture and a trigger condition for the setting;

generating a sleep profile with the setting and trigger condition;

activating the sleep profile when the trigger condition has been met; and

based on the activation of the sleep profile, transmitting a signal from a central controller of the bed architecture to the component to adjust to the setting.

2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ein receiving the trigger condition for the setting includes receiving a time-based trigger condition indicating a time to adjust the component.

3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ein receiving the trigger condition for the setting include receiving an event-based trigger condition indicating a state of sleep of a user.

4 . The method of claim 3 , further comprising:

determining the event-based trigger condition has been met based on analyzing biometric parameters of a user using the bed architecture.

5 . The method of claim 4 , wherein the biometric parameters are collected using a pressure sensor of the bed architecture.

6 . The method of claim 4 , wherein analyzing the biometric parameters of the user includes determining a sleep state of the user.

7 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

monitoring biometric parameters of a user in relationship to the setting of the component;

recommending a different setting of the component based on the monitoring; and

updating the sleep profile with the different setting based on receiving an indication the recommended different setting was accepted by the user.

8 . A system comprising:

at least one processor;

a storage device including instructions, which when executed by the at least one processor, configure the at least one processor to:

receive a setting for a component of a bed architecture and a trigger condition for the setting;

generate a sleep profile with the setting and trigger condition;

activate the sleep profile when the trigger condition has been met; and

based on the activation of the sleep profile, transmit a signal from a central controller of the bed architecture to the component to adjust to the setting.

9 . The system of claim 8 , wherein the setting for the component includes a temperature setting for a pad of the bed architecture.

10 . The system of claim 8 , wherein the setting for the component includes a pressure setting of an air mattress of the bed architecture.

11 . The system of claim 8 , wherein the setting for the component includes a position setting of a foundation of the bed architecture.

12 . The system of claim 8 , wherein the trigger condition includes a sleep state of a user of the bed architecture.

13 . The system of claim 12 , wherein the at least one processor is configured to monitor a sleep state of the user to determine when to activate the sleep profile.

14 . A non-transitory computer-readable medium including instructions, which when executed by at least one processor, cause the at least one processor to:

establish a sleep pattern of a user of a bed architecture;

determine, using a central controller of the bed architecture, an adjustment to make to a component of the bed architecture based on the sleep pattern;

initiate the adjustment to the component; and

request feedback from the user with respect to the adjustment.

15 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 14 , wherein the instructions further cause the at least one processor to establish a sleep pattern of a user of a bed architecture by:

monitoring biometric parameters of the user during sleep; and

calculating a restfulness index of the user.

16 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 14 , wherein the instructions further cause the at least one processor to determine an adjustment to make to a component of the bed architecture based on the sleep pattern by:

determining a pressure setting adjustment for an air mattress of the bed architecture.

17 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 14 , wherein the instructions further cause the at least one processor to determine an adjustment to make to a component of the bed architecture based on the sleep pattern by:

determining a temperature setting adjustment for a pad of the bed architecture.

18 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 14 , wherein the instructions further cause the at least one processor to:

determine another adjustment to make to a component of the bed architecture based on the feedback.

19 . The non-transitory computer-readable medium of claim 14 , wherein the instructions further cause the at least one processor to:

present the adjustment of the component as a recommendation to the user.
